Pacific Ridge is 0-10 against Francis Parker since January of 2016 but things could change on Friday. The Pacific Ridge Firebirds will host the Francis Parker Lancers at 3:15 p.m. Pacific Ridge's last three matches have been decided by no more than a goal, so don't be surprised if it's a close one.
On Wednesday, Pacific Ridge didn't have quite enough to beat Classical Academy and fell 2-1. Evie Spengler was hit with a yellow card, which may have had some impact on her (and the team's) ability to make aggressive plays.
Pacific Ridge's goal came courtesy of Calista Lowery, which was the first she's scored this season.
Meanwhile, win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Francis Parker). They never let La Jolla Country Day onto the board and left with a 6-0 victory on Wednesday. The result kept the Lancers happy, as they haven't lost a game since December 20, 2024.
Francis Parker has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won four of their last five games, which provided a massive bump to their 6-5-2 record this season. Those victories came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they scored 15 goals over those five contests. As for Pacific Ridge, their loss was their first in the league, dropping their league record down to 0-1-2 and their overall record down to 2-6-2.
Pacific Ridge suffered a grim 5-2 defeat to Francis Parker in their previous matchup back in February of 2024. Can Pacific Ridge avenge their defeat or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
